#723e99 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#723e99 is composed of 44.7% red, 24.3%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 25.5% cyan, 59.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 274.3 degrees, a saturation of 42.3% and a lightness of 42.2%. #723e99 color hex could be obtained by blending #e47cff with #000033.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#723e99 color description : Dark moderate violet.

#723e99 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#723e99 has RGB values of R:114, G:62, B:153 and CMYK values of C:0.25, M:0.59,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 7487129.

Shades and Tints of #723e99

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a050d is the darkest color, while #fffe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#723e99

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6c6770 is the less saturated color, while #7a04d3 is the most saturated one.
